Barking Angels Service Dog Foundation provides service dogs and companion dogs to developmentally disabled, physically disabled, hearing impaired, and mentally impaired individuals. These dogs assist disabled individuals with everyday activities giving people more independence and a new outlook on life. Both service dogs and companion dogs are available and are trained to meet the specific needs of each individual. Both male and female dogs are accepted into the program. We have breeds of all types, but most are Labrador Retrievers, Golden Retrievers, and Golden Doodles (for individuals with possible allergies), and some mixed breeds. The cost for each Service/Companion Dog will be determined by the extent of training, skills needed, and if the dog is certified for public access.
